fix(订单服务): 修复订单采购服务中的验证逻辑和状态处理

- 移除OrderPurchaseDto中Id字段的必填验证
- 修改ProWorkorderMaterialService中的订单筛选条件
- 增强AddOrderPurchase和UpdateOrderPurchase方法的验证逻辑
- 为订单添加初始状态值和事务处理
- 修复导入日期处理和空值判断
This commit is contained in:
2026-02-03 10:12:30 +08:00
parent 3f8b6c3ea9
commit c6efde0593
3 changed files with 75 additions and 12 deletions

View File

@@ -46,7 +46,6 @@ namespace DOAN.Model.MES.order.Dto
/// </summary>
public class OrderPurchaseDto
{
[Required(ErrorMessage = "雪花id不能为空")]
public string Id { get; set; }
public DateTime? ImportDate { get; set; }